HP 8920 Parts List and Schematics Manual Overview
The HP 8920 is a versatile and reliable communication test set widely used in field servicing and laboratory environments. Designed primarily for testing and troubleshooting radio communication equipment, this device supports a range of analog and digital radio standards. The HP 8920 enables technicians to perform signal analysis, frequency measurements, and modulation tests with high accuracy, making it an essential tool for maintaining and repairing communication systems.

Basic Usage and Operation Tips
Before operating the HP 8920, ensure the device is properly calibrated according to the manual’s instructions. Connect the test leads securely to the device under test (DUT) and select the appropriate frequency band and modulation mode. Use the signal generator to inject test signals and observe the receiver’s response on the display. Regularly check the battery level to avoid interruptions during fieldwork. Refer to the schematics for detailed component locations when performing repairs or modifications.
Troubleshooting and Maintenance Notes
If the HP 8920 exhibits unexpected behavior such as signal distortion or display errors, consult the troubleshooting section of the manual for step-by-step diagnostics. Common issues include loose connectors, depleted batteries, or faulty internal components. Routine maintenance involves cleaning connectors, inspecting cables for damage, and verifying calibration accuracy. Always use original replacement parts as listed in the parts list to maintain device integrity.
